1 dead, 196 nabbed in 3-day police operations in Quezon province

LUCENA CITY — The three-day simultaneous police operations in Quezon province led to the death of an alleged drug pusher and arrests of 196 suspected criminals, police said Thursday.

Police operations in 39 towns and two cities from September 21 to 23 led to the arrests of 38 alleged drug pushers, Colonel Audie Madrideo, Quezon police director, said in a report.

Alleged drug peddler Ricardo Villarante was killed after he reportedly resisted arrest in a buy-bust operation and engaged policemen in a shootout in Lucena City on Monday.

Anti-illegal drugs operatives also seized 37.27 grams of “shabu” (crystal meth) worth P205,000 in the street market and 2,435.4 grams of marijuana with Dangerous Drugs Board value of P133,947.

Police also arrested nine suspects on illegal firearms charges; 20 for illegal gambling; 20 for illegal fishing; four for illegal logging; 10 for illegal cutting of coconut trees; and 11 others for violations of municipal ordinances.

Police also arrested 84 wanted felons. /lzb
